Создание собственных виджетов: использование кэша?
Я в процессе создания собственного виджета, но мне не нравится, когда он каждый раз полностью генерирует контент, так как процесс довольно длительный. Я могу легко создать свой собственный механизм кэширования, но мне интересно, есть ли что-то, что уже существует в ядре wordpress, когда дело доходит до кэширования виджетов.
Идеи?
Спасибо! Деннис
1 answers
Взгляните на API переходных процессов WordPress
, который предлагает простой и стандартизированный способ временного хранения кэшированных данных в базе данных, предоставляя им пользовательское имя и временные рамки, по истечении которых они истекут и будут удалены.
API переходных процессов очень похож на API опций, но с добавленной функцией времени истечения срока действия, что упрощает процесс использования таблицы базы данных wp_options для хранения кэшированных информация.